After undergoing FaceTite in Bendigo, it's crucial to follow specific post-procedure guidelines to ensure optimal healing and results. Here are some key things to avoid:
Avoid Direct Sun Exposure: Protect your skin from the sun for at least four weeks post-procedure. UV rays can cause hyperpigmentation and hinder the healing process. Always ap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30.
Do Not Smoke: Smoking can significantly impair blood circulation, which is essential for proper healing. It can also lead to complications such as delayed wound healing and increased risk of infection.
Avoid Strenuous Activities: Refrain from intense physical activities, including heavy lifting and vigorous exercise, for at least two weeks. These activities can increase blood flow and potentially cause bleeding or swelling.
Do Not Touch or Rub the Treated Area: Avoid touching, rubbing, or applying pressure to the treated areas. This can disrupt the healing process and may lead to uneven results.
Avoid Hot Showers and Saunas: Keep your showers lukewarm and avoid hot baths, saunas, or hot tubs for at least two weeks. Excessive heat can cause swelling and discomfort.
Do Not Use Harsh Skincare Products: Avoid using any harsh or abrasive skincare products, including exfoliants and retinoids, for at least two weeks. Stick to gentle, fragrance-free products to prevent irritation.
Avoid Alcohol and Blood Thinners: Refrain from consuming alcohol and avoid medications that thin the blood, such as aspirin and ibuprofen, as they can increase the risk of bleeding and bruising.
By adhering to these guidelines, you can help ensure a smooth recovery and achieve the best possible results from your FaceTite procedure in Bendigo. Always consult with your healthcare provider for personalized advice and any specific instructions related to your treatment.

Quitting Smoking for Better Circulation
Smoking is another critical factor to address post-FaceTite. Nicotine, a major component of cigarettes, constricts blood vessels and impairs blood circulation. This can lead to slower healing times and may increase the risk of complications such as infection or poor wound healing. Encouraging patients to quit smoking before and after the procedure is essential for maintaining healthy blood flow and ensuring a smooth recovery.

Avoiding Excessive Heat and Irritants Post-FaceTite in Bendigo
After undergoing FaceTite in Bendigo, it is crucial to follow specific post-treatment care guidelines to ensure optimal results and minimize any potential complications. One of the key aspects of this care involves avoiding activities and products that could exacerbate swelling or cause skin irritation.
Steer Clear of Hot Baths and Saunas
Engaging in activities that expose your skin to excessive heat should be avoided. This includes hot baths and saunas. The heat from these environments can lead to increased blood flow, which may result in heightened swelling and discomfort. Swelling is a common side effect of FaceTite, and while it is temporary, it is essential to manage it effectively to promote healing. By avoiding hot environments, you can help reduce the likelihood of unnecessary swelling and ensure a smoother recovery process.
Opt for Gentle Skincare Products
In addition to avoiding heat, it is equally important to be mindful of the skincare products you use post-procedure. Avoiding any products that contain harsh chemicals or fragrances is advisable. These can be particularly irritating to the skin, which is already in a sensitive state following FaceTite. Instead, opt for gentle, fragrance-free products that are specifically designed for sensitive skin. This will help prevent any additional irritation and support the natural healing process of your skin.
Why These Measures Matter
The rationale behind these precautions is rooted in the nature of the FaceTite procedure itself. FaceTite involves the use of radiofrequency energy to melt fat and tighten the skin, which can lead to temporary swelling and sensitivity. By avoiding heat and harsh products, you are essentially creating an environment that is conducive to healing. This not only helps in reducing post-procedure discomfort but also ensures that the results of the FaceTite are fully realized and long-lasting.
